Think of them as Tonalities instead of Keys. They are scales that are all based on the Major Scale. There are 7 Sharps: F#, C#, G#, D#, A#, E#, and B# which give us the Major Keys of: G, D, A, E, B, F#, and C#.Įach Major Key (the Ionian Mode) has a relative minor (the Aeolian Mode), so we need to double the Total, giving us 30 Keys.īe careful not to confuse the other modes, Dorian, Phrygian, Lydian, Mixolydian and Locrian, with Keys. There are 7 Flats: Bb, Eb, Ab, Db, Gb, Cb, Fb creating the Major Keys of F, Bb, Eb, Ab, Db, Gb and Cb. As long as you know the order of Flats and the order of Sharps, it’s very easy to understand.Ĭonsider that there is ONE key with NO Sharps nor Flats: The Key of C It’s really quite logical and uses a bit of Music Theory knowledge.
